.snav { font-size: 7pt; font-family: arial, Helvetica, sans-serif; background-image: url(img/bg/bg_snav.gif); background-repeat: repeat-x; text-transform: uppercase; text-align: left; vertical-align: middle; width: 900px; height: 20px; float: none; min-width: 900px; min-height: 20px; max-width: 900px; max-height: 20px; }
.theme { background-image: url(img/bg/bg_theme.gif); background-repeat: no-repeat; background-position: left 0; text-align: right; width: 900px; height: 135px; float: none; min-width: 900px; min-height: 135px; max-width: 900px; max-height: 135px; }
.mnav { font-family: arial, Helvetica, sans-serif; line-height: 100%; background-image: url(img/bg/bg_mnav.jpg); background-repeat: repeat; background-position: left 0; text-transform: uppercase; text-align: left; vertical-align: middle; width: 900px; height: 25px; float: none; min-width: 900px; min-height: 25px; max-width: 900px; max-height: 25px; margin: 0; padding: 0; }
.mnav_abstand { font-family: arial, Helvetica, sans-serif; line-height: 100%; background-image: url(img/bg/bg_mnav_abstand.jpg); background-repeat: repeat; background-position: left 0; text-transform: uppercase; text-align: left; vertical-align: middle; width: 900px; height: 30px; float: none; min-width: 900px; min-height: 30px; max-width: 900px; max-height: 30px; }
.content { width: 900px; height:auto ; float: none; clear: none; }

.content_subnav { background-image: none; background-repeat: repeat; background-attachment: scroll; background-position: 0 0; width:160px; height:auto; float:left; }
.content_teasers { background-image: none; background-repeat: repeat; background-attachment: scroll; background-position: 0 0; width:210px; height:auto; float:right; }
.content_content { background-image: none; background-repeat: repeat; background-attachment: scroll; background-position: 0 0; width:500px; height:auto; margin-left:170px; margin-right:220px; }
.teaserbox_kopf { background-image: url(img/bg/bg_teaserbox_head.jpg); width: 200px; height:20px ; min-width: 200px; min-height: 20px; max-width: 200px; max-height: 20px; }
.teaserbox_text { width: 190px; height:auto ; min-width: 190px; max-width: 190px; margin-right: 5px; margin-bottom: 20px; margin-left: 5px; }
.header { text-align: left; height: 20px; min-height: 20px; max-height: 20px; margin-bottom: 10px; padding-bottom: 10px; }


.gal_kopf { color: #fff; font-size: 10pt; font-family: Helvetica, Geneva, Arial, SunSans-Regular, sans-serif; background-image: url(img/gallerie/bg.gif); height: 80px; width: 800px; left: 0; top: 0; position: absolute; visibility: visible; }
.gal_bild { text-align: center; vertical-align: middle; height: 420px; width: 570px; left: 10px; top: 80px; position: absolute; visibility: visible; }
.gal_teaser { height: 490px; width: 190px; left: 600px; top: 80px; position: absolute; visibility: visible; }
.gal_bildtext { height: 70px; width: 570px; left: 10px; top: 500px; position: absolute; visibility: visible; }
.gal_zurueck { background-image: url(img/gallerie/bg2.gif); text-transform: uppercase; height: 30px; width: 100px; left: 0; top: 570px; position: absolute; visibility: visible; }
.gal_seitenangabe { background-image: url(img/gallerie/bg2.gif); text-transform: uppercase;height: 30px; width: 600px; left: 100px; top: 570px; position: absolute; visibility: visible; }
.gal_vor { background-image: url(img/gallerie/bg2.gif); text-transform: uppercase; height: 30px; width: 100px; left: 700px; top: 570px; position: absolute; visibility: visible; }
.gal_header { margin-top: 20px; margin-left: 10px; }
.gal_titel { font-weight: bold; text-transform: uppercase; }
.gal_navigation { font-size: 8pt; text-transform: uppercase; margin-top: 12px; margin-right: 10px; margin-left: 10px; }